1945 August
On the Pacific front, American Secret Services, after intercepting Japanese government messages, are convinced they will not accept unconditional surrender. The Secretary of the Navy, James R. Forrestal, says that, in his opinion, despite the circumstances in which they find themselves, the Japanese are determined to continue the war. In western Japan, the city of Hiroshima, in the Chugoku region, lies on a plain on the Ota River delta, which divides the city into six islands.
